Introduction to White Label Web Design

White label web design is a business model where one company provides web design and development services to other businesses, which then rebrand and sell these services as their own. This practice allows companies to expand their service offerings without the need to hire an in-house design team. It’s a win-win situation, as clients receive professional web design, and businesses offering white label services profit from the partnership.

Understanding White Label Services

What is White Labeling?

White labeling involves taking a product or service created by one company and rebranding it as if it were your own. In the context of web design, a white label service provider creates websites for other businesses, and these businesses can present the websites as their own work.

 

How Does White Label Web Design Work?

The process typically begins with a partnership agreement between a white label service provider and a business seeking web design services. The client shares their requirements and preferences, and the white label provider designs and develops the website according to these specifications. The client can then market the website under their brand name.

 

Benefits of White Label Web Design

Cost-Efficiency

One of the primary benefits of white label web design is cost-efficiency. Businesses can save on the expenses of hiring and training an in-house design team, which includes salaries, benefits, and ongoing training.

 

Time-Saving

White label services save time for businesses, as they can provide web design solutions to their clients without the delays associated with hiring and training a team.

 

Access to Expertise

By partnering with a white label web design agency, businesses gain access to a team of experts who specialize in web design and development. This expertise can result in high-quality, professional websites.

 

Who Can Benefit from White Label Web Design?

Businesses of all sizes can benefit from white label web design. Whether you’re a small agency looking to expand your services or a large corporation seeking to streamline operations, white label web design offers a flexible solution.

 

How to Choose the Right White Label Web Design Partner

To ensure a successful white label partnership, it’s essential to choose the right service provider. Consider the following factors when making your selection:

 

Portfolio Assessment

Review the provider’s portfolio to assess the quality and style of their work. Ensure it aligns with your client’s needs and expectations.

 

Communication and Support

Effective communication is crucial for a successful partnership. Choose a provider that offers clear and responsive communication channels.

 

Pricing Structure

Consider the pricing structure offered by the white label service provider. It should be competitive and aligned with your budget and expected profit margins.

 

The Process of White Label Web Design

Initial Consultation

The process begins with an initial consultation, where the client discusses their requirements, goals, and expectations. This is the foundation for the project’s scope and design.

 

Design and Development

The white label provider designs and develops the website according to the client’s specifications. The client can provide feedback and request revisions during this stage.

 

Review and Revisions

The client reviews the website and provides feedback. Any necessary revisions are made to ensure the website meets the client’s expectations.

Launch

Once the client approves the website, it is ready for launch. The website goes live, and the client can begin promoting it to their audience.

Conclusion

White label web design is a flexible and cost-effective solution for businesses looking to offer professional web design services. By choosing the right white label partner and following best practices, businesses can expand their service offerings and meet their clients’ web design needs efficiently.

 

FAQs

  1. Is white label web design suitable for small businesses?

Yes, white label web design is suitable for businesses of all sizes. It offers cost-effective solutions for small agencies and can streamline operations for larger corporations.

 

  1. How do I choose the right white label web design partner?

Choose a partner based on their portfolio, communication capabilities, and pricing structure. Ensure their expertise aligns with your client’s needs.

 

  1. What is the typical turnaround time for a white label web design project?

The turnaround time varies based on the project’s complexity and the client’s feedback. However, white label services generally save time compared to in-house design.

 

  1. What happens if the client is not satisfied with the white label web design?

Reputable white label providers offer revisions to address client concerns. Effective communication is key to ensuring client satisfaction.

 

  1. Can I maintain the confidentiality of my white label partnership?

Yes, white label agreements typically include confidentiality clauses to protect your business and your client relationships.
